经筋刺法联合任务导向性训练对中风后偏瘫患者姿势控制及运动功能的影响
The Effect of Meridian Acupuncture Combined with Task-Oriented Training on Posture Control and Motor Function in Post-Stroke Hemiplegic Patients

Objective:To analyze the influence of meridian acupuncture combined with task-oriented training on posture control and motor function of post-stroke hemiplegic patients.Methods:Sixty post-stroke hemiplegic patients admitted to our hospital from January to December 2024 were randomly divided into a control group and an observation group,with 30 cases in each group,under the guidance of a random number table method.The control group received task-oriented training,while the observation group re-ceived a combination of meridian acupuncture and task-oriented training.The effects of the modified Berg Balance Scale(mBBS),Fugl-Meyer Motor Function Assessment Scale,muscle strength(peak torque and average power),gait(walking speed,walking fre-quency,and stride ratio),and Barthel's Index(BI)were observed and compared between the two groups before and after treatment.Results:After treatment,the mBBS score,Fugl-Meyer score,BI score,muscle peak torque,average power,walking speed,walking frequency,and stride ratio of both groups of patients increased compared to before treatment(P<0.05),and the observation group had significantly higher mBBS score,Fugl-Meyer score,BI score,muscle peak torque,average power,walking speed,walking fre-quency,and stride ratio after treatment than the control group(P<0.05).Conclusion:The combination of meridian acupuncture and task-oriented training can effectively improve the balance and motor function of post-stroke hemiplegic patients,enhance lower limb muscle strength,and improve gait.关键词
